Though Uphall Station may not have a traditional ticket office, worry not as ticket machines are available on-site for your convenience. These machines allow travelers to collect tickets bought online and support smartcard validation. The station is partially accessible with ramps to both platforms, although please bear in mind that there are no step-free accessible trains.
Passengers can rely on CCTV surveillance and customer help points for a safer journey. However, do note that the station lacks certain facilities like toilets, refreshment options, and Wi-Fi. For those who require assistance, help points are available, and inquiries can be made through customer.relations@scotrail.co.uk for any additional support or information.
Whether you need to hop on a bus or call a taxi, Uphall Station is linked to various transport options. Rail replacement services conveniently pick up and drop off passengers at designated bus stops nearby — details can be found using the ///what3words address. For local bus services, the TravelLine Scotland service is your go-to resource. As for taxis, you might want to visit traintaxi.co.uk for the closest available options.

While Inverness Airport train station is modest in terms of facilities, it ensures functionality for its users. Although there's no ticket office, ticket machines are available, allowing you to collect tickets bought online with ease. The station supports users with step-free access throughout, making it a category A station. This is a big plus point for passengers with mobility issues. Furthermore, there are four Blue Badge holder spaces to make your travel experience more convenient. No toilets or refreshment facilities seem to be on hand, so ensure you're prepared beforehand.
The lack of staff presence means that passenger assistance is limited to help points. Travelers are encouraged to make use of these points for information and guidance if needed. CCTV coverage contributes to station security, ensuring peace of mind while you wait for your train under the shelter on the platforms.
Situated conveniently close to Inverness Airport, this train station is well-connected by various transport modes. Buses operate between the station and the airport terminal, making the interchange smooth for travelers. The Inverness Airport station also offers connections via local bus services, with information available at Traveline Scotland.
If taxis are what you're looking for, the site Train Taxi provides the necessary details including options for accessible taxis. Although there’s no immediate car park dedicated to the station, there are shared spaces available.
